Mr. Ginsburg has over 26 years experience in management and programming in various fields of data processing and data communications in the banking, brokerage and engineering industries.
Presently, Mr. Ginsburg serves as Vice President of Citicorp's Global Technology Organization where he manages the communications software area. Mr. Ginsburg has worked for Citicorp for over 15 years, having been involved with Citicorp's Y2K initiative and having overseen Citicorp's implementation of some of the first Web enabling technologies and TCP/IP on mainframe computers and router based communications networks in the banking industry.
Also while at Citicorp, Mr. Ginsburg was in charge of communications hardware and software strategic planning with responsibilities for the network design, organization and integration to enhance network capabilities.
Prior to joining Citicorp in 1985, Mr. Ginsburg held a senior technical position at Prudential Securities and Gibbs & Hills, Inc. Mr. Ginsburg holds both Bachelor and Master Degrees in Mathematics. |
